Introducing the LTC4230IGN from Linear Technology
The LTC4230IGN is a highly integrated solution from Linear Technology, designed to simplify the management of power in complex systems. This hot swap controller is engineered to ensure safe board insertion and extraction from a live backplane. It is housed in a robust SSOP package, making it a durable and reliable choice for demanding applications.
Key Features
- Hot Swap Control: The LTC4230IGN allows for the safe insertion and removal of circuit boards from a live backplane, minimizing the risk of damage caused by arcing or system disruption.
- Integrated MOSFET: With an integrated N-channel MOSFET, this controller can handle the high current requirements of modern electronic systems, providing efficient power distribution and protection.
- Adjustable Current Limit: Users can set the current limit threshold according to their specific application needs, ensuring that the system remains within safe operating conditions.
- Overcurrent Protection: The device features robust overcurrent protection, which helps to prevent damage to the board and other system components in the event of a fault condition.
- Power Good Output: A 'power good' output signal is provided, which can be used to enable downstream converters, ensuring that power is stable and within specifications before allowing the system to proceed.
- Wide Operating Voltage Range: The LTC4230IGN is designed to operate over a wide voltage range, accommodating various applications and ensuring compatibility with different system voltages.
